Akumajou Dracula

Akumajou Dracula is a platform game developed by Konami. The first part of the popular game Castlevania. A hero armed with a whip fights against crowds of evil spirits and living skeletons with one goal: to get to the center of world evil - Count Dracula. The game plot is simple as never before. With a whip, you can not only kill enemies, but also knock out bonuses in the form of hearts and bags of money from candlesticks. The game was originally released in Japan on floppy disks for the Famicom Disk System, but in 1993 it was re-released for this region and on cartridges.

Castlevania (in the Japanese version of Akumajou Dracula) is a typical 8-bit era platformer. Along with Super Mario Bros., Tiny Toon Adventures and many other classic games, it once shaped the players' idea of ​​what a modern, interesting, high-quality platformer should be like. The main character of the game is Simon Belmont. Armed with a Vampire Killer whip, he exterminates evil spirits and brings light to the world. His task is to go through many trials and defeat Count Dracula himself.

Castlevania consists of six levels, which are completed in the only possible way, without plot branches and alternative levels. Each of these levels inevitably ends with a boss fight.

Unlike other platformers, here jumping is possible only to the left and right, there is no possibility to control the hero in the air. This can sometimes get on your nerves, because a slightly inaccurate calculation can instantly lead to the loss of a life. Jumping in this game must be filigree. By collecting bonuses, you can increase the length of the whip (and hit enemies at a safer distance from you), as well as get some additional types of weapons.

After defeating Dracula, an additional level of difficulty appears - Hard Mode. You start the game again, while retaining all the additional weapons that you had at the time the game ended. The difficulty lies in the fact that you die after only four hits (twice as fast). On each screen, either a bat or a jellyfish head flies additionally. But at the same time, secret places are also added where you can get additional items.
